Plant Functioning

FERROUS METALS SEPARATION

A chain conveyor carries the material to the top of the plant. The material flow is forced through 2 opposed Deferrizing Magnetic Drums that separate effectively the ferrous materials.
This machine is equipped with special hoods that suck in light contaminants.

PRODUCT FRACTIONING

The deferrized material, composed by wood, plastic, cellophane, etc enters the first classification section. Here, 2 Screens, a hexagonal shape Primary Roller Screen, followed by a cylindrical shape Secondary Roller Screen allow for a homogeneous dimensional separation of the materials.

Four fractions are produced: fines, micro chips, macro chips which will be cleaned by the plant, and oversizes which will be disposed for further re-chipping.

This section is equipped with special hoods that suck the light contaminants.

CLEANING OF FINES BY GRAVIMETRIC SEPARATION

The fine fraction is fed by a series of screws to the Gravimetric Separator. In this machine the heavy pollutants (stones, glass, plastic, etc…) fall to the bottom while a flow of air carries light material to the following machine.

CLEANING OF MICRO & MACRO CHIPS BY VARIOUS SEPARATORS

Two Kinetic Separators separate heavy bodies (stones, glass, metals, wood agglomerates, plastic agglomerates, rubber, etc…) and light particles from the wood chips flow by means of injected air.

Then, clean micro & macro chips enter 2 Induction Separators which separate non-ferrous materials (aluminium, copper, brass, etc…) by means of eddy currents created by a pulsating magnetic field.

Uncertain material, composed of heavy pollutants and pieces of wood, coming from Gravimetric & Kinetic Separators is introduced in the Water Separator, which allows to further recover wood and eliminates heavy pollutants for good.

PNEUMATIC SCREEN

Clean fines obtained by the Gravimetric Separator will be processed by the Pneumatic Screen. This is a newly developed system that allows to separate the dust wood useful as fuel from the particles destined to production. The Pneumatic screen is characterized by an innovative concept of fluid dynamic cleaning. It eliminates the clogging of the net mesh and its mechanical wear, making constant the final product quality.

LPD CYCLONES

The plant is equipped with state of the art LPD (Low Pressure Drop) Cyclones which separate material at lower air speed compared to traditional cyclones. Such new design allows for a very important saving in Kw absorption, wear and footprint.
